The 1% risk-per-trade framework, revisited

The single position-sizing rule that separates career traders from career blowups.

By Tradify Editorial · 26 January 2026

The 1% rule is the most quoted and least understood idea in retail trading. Quoted, because it fits in a tweet. Misunderstood, because most people hear 'put 1% of your account into the trade' when it actually means 'lose no more than 1% of your account if the trade is wrong'. Those are wildly different instructions, and confusing them is how accounts die.

The arithmetic you cannot argue with

Position size is determined by three numbers: account equity, risk percentage, and the distance from entry to invalidation. Size equals (equity × risk%) ÷ (distance to stop). Nothing about conviction, news, or how good the chart looks enters the formula. Conviction can adjust the risk percentage within a narrow band; it can never override the stop distance.

Say the account is Rs. 500,000 and risk is 1%, so Rs. 5,000 is at stake. If your invalidation sits 2% below entry, the position is Rs. 250,000. If invalidation sits 8% below entry, the same Rs. 5,000 of risk buys only Rs. 62,500 of exposure. Wider stops mean smaller positions. Traders who ignore this end up with their largest positions on their loosest setups — precisely backwards.

Why 1% and not 5%

Because of the recovery curve. Lose 10% and you need 11% to get back to flat. Lose 30% and you need 43%. Lose 50% and you need a 100% return — a full doubling — just to return to where you started. Drawdowns are not symmetrical, and the asymmetry gets vicious fast.

At 1% risk per trade, a brutal ten-loss streak costs roughly 10% and is entirely survivable. At 5% risk, the same streak removes about 40% of the account and requires a 67% return to recover. The strategy did not change. Only the sizing did — and the sizing decided whether you have a career.

Streaks are longer than you think

With a 45% win rate, the probability of hitting an eight-loss streak somewhere inside two hundred trades is high enough that you should plan for it as an ordinary event, not a catastrophe. Two hundred trades is a single busy year for an active trader. Your sizing must assume that year contains its worst stretch, and that the worst stretch arrives at the least convenient moment.

Total risk, not just per-trade risk

Per-trade risk is only half the picture. Correlated positions are one position wearing several names. Three long positions in different large-cap tech names at 1% each is not 1% risk three times — on a broad risk-off day it behaves closer to a single 3% bet. The same applies to holding several altcoins, or being long three pairs that all short the dollar.

  • Cap total open risk at 3–5% of equity across all positions.
  • Group correlated instruments and treat the group as one risk unit.
  • Cap daily loss at roughly 3% — hit it and the session ends, regardless of how good the next setup looks.
  • Cap monthly drawdown at 6–10%; breaching it means halving size until the equity curve stabilises.

Scaling risk with the equity curve

Fixed-fractional sizing does something elegant automatically: as equity falls, position size falls with it, so a drawdown decelerates itself. Some traders add a manual overlay — dropping to 0.5% risk after a defined drawdown and returning to full size only after recovering a set amount. It slows the recovery slightly and dramatically reduces the odds of a terminal loss. That trade is worth making every time.

Position sizing is the only part of trading where you get to choose your outcome distribution in advance.

Where the rule breaks

The 1% rule assumes your stop will fill near your level. Gaps, weekend news, exchange outages and thin liquidity break that assumption. In leveraged crypto and small-cap equities, a 1% planned risk can become a 4% realised loss. The remedies are unglamorous: smaller size in illiquid or gap-prone instruments, no oversized positions carried across weekends or major data releases, and treating leverage as a tool for capital efficiency rather than a way to smuggle in more risk.

The rule is not sacred at exactly 1%. A conservative swing trader might run 0.5%; a disciplined professional with tight, well-tested stops might run 2%. What is sacred is that the number is chosen before the trade, written down, and identical whether or not you love the setup. Every account that ever went to zero did so because someone decided one particular trade deserved an exception.
